1. The Importance of Small Business Accounting


Before we dive into the realm of accounting software, it’s essential to understand the importance of accounting for small businesses. Accurate financial records and effective bookkeeping practices provide business owners with valuable insights into their company’s financial health. By maintaining accurate records, small business owners can:

  • Make informed decisions based on real-time financial data.
  • Monitor cash flow and manage expenses effectively.
  • Comply with tax regulations and reduce the risk of audits.
  • Improve financial transparency for investors, partners, and stakeholders.
  • Streamline invoicing and payment processes for better client relationships.

2. Benefits of Small Business Accounting Software


Small business accounting software offers numerous advantages over traditional manual bookkeeping methods. Here are some key benefits:

  • Time and cost savings: Accounting software automates repetitive tasks, reducing the time and effort required for manual data entry, reconciliation, and reporting. This translates into cost savings by minimizing the need for additional staff or external accounting services.
  • Accuracy and reduced errors: By automating calculations and data entry, accounting software reduces the risk of human error, ensuring accurate financial records.
  • Financial visibility: Accounting software provides real-time insights into your business’s financial health, including cash flow, profit and loss statements, balance sheets, and more. These reports help you make informed decisions and plan for the future.
  • Scalability: As your small business grows, accounting software can scale with your needs, accommodating an expanding customer base, increased transactions, and additional employees.

3. Key Features to Consider


When selecting the best accounting software for your small business, consider the following essential features:

  • Invoicing and billing: Look for software that simplifies the process of creating and sending professional invoices, tracking payments, and managing billing cycles.
  • Expense tracking: The software should allow you to record and categorize expenses, track receipts, and generate expense reports to facilitate budgeting and tax deductions.
  • Bank reconciliation: Ensure that the software integrates with your bank accounts and credit cards, automating the reconciliation process and reducing errors.
  • Financial reporting: Look for robust reporting capabilities, including profit and loss statements, balance sheets, cash flow statements, and customizable reports to suit your specific needs.
  • Inventory management: If your business involves inventory, consider software that offers inventory tracking and management features, helping you monitor stock levels and streamline ordering processes.
  • Tax compliance: Choose accounting software that assists with tax-related tasks, such as calculating taxes owed, generating tax reports, and simplifying the process of filing tax returns.

4. Top Small Business Accounting Software Solutions


There are several outstanding accounting software solutions available for small businesses. Here are three popular options:

  • QuickBooks: Known for its user-friendly interface and comprehensive features, QuickBooks offers a range of plans suitable for small businesses of all sizes. It provides invoicing, expense tracking, financial reporting, and tax preparation capabilities.
  • Xero: Xero is a cloud-based accounting software that offers robust features such as invoicing, bank reconciliation, expense tracking, and integrated payroll functionality. It also integrates with a wide range of third-party applications.
  • FreshBooks: Ideal for service-based businesses, FreshBooks simplifies invoicing, time tracking, and expense management. It offers intuitive reporting features, client portals for collaboration, and integration with popular payment gateways.
